内蒙古科技大学数据库实训《我的租房网》

内蒙古科技大学数据库实训《我的租房网》

ID:45113286

大小:1.43 MB

页数:26页

时间:2019-11-10

内蒙古科技大学数据库实训《我的租房网》_第1页
内蒙古科技大学数据库实训《我的租房网》_第2页
内蒙古科技大学数据库实训《我的租房网》_第3页
内蒙古科技大学数据库实训《我的租房网》_第4页
内蒙古科技大学数据库实训《我的租房网》_第5页
资源描述:

《内蒙古科技大学数据库实训《我的租房网》》由会员上传分享,免费在线阅读,更多相关内容在行业资料-天天文库

1、《数据库技术与应用》工程实训设计报告《我的租房网》综合性实验设计报告学号:不填学生姓名:陈伟光专业:软件工程指导教师:余金玲完成日期:2017年11月2日T-SQL文件和SQLserver数据下载地址在心得体会处显示251567159118陈伟光《我的租房网》实训报告《数据库技术与应用》工程实训设计报告内蒙古科技大学实训任务书课程名称数据库技术与应用程序设计设计题目《我的租房网》综合性设计指导教师余金玲时间2017.10.20-2017.11.21、项目任务1.T-SQL编程创建事物产生随机测试数据2.实现各种业务查询功能2、项目技能目标1.使用临时表保存临时查询结果2.使用子查询、

2、联接查询、联合查询3.使用事务和视图4.使用T-SQL编程批量插入测试数据3、需求概述项目组接受开发“我的租房网”软件任务,现在项目组接受数据库设计工作,“我的租房网”数据库House包括客户信息表、区县信息表、街道信息表、房屋类型表和出租房屋信息表共5个表,各表结构如下表1-5所示:表1.客户信息表house_user结构列名称数据类型说明UserIdint客户编号,主键,标识列从1开始,递增值为1UserNamevarchar客户姓名,该栏必填UserPwdvarchar密码,至少6个字符UserRegDateDate登记日期,日期类型,要求大于2013-1-1后,小于当前日期表

3、2.区县信息表house_district结构列名称数据类型说明DIdint区县编号,主键,标识列从1开始,递增值为1DNamevarchar区县名称,该栏必填表3.街道信息表house_street结构列名称数据类型说明StreetIdint街道编号,主键,标识列从1开始,递增值为1SNamevarchar街道名称,该栏必填SDIdvarchar区县编号,表house_district的外键表4.房屋类型表house_type结构列名称数据类型说明HTIdint房屋类型编号,主键,标识列从1开始,递增值为1251567159118陈伟光《我的租房网》实训报告《数据库技术与应用》工程

4、实训设计报告HTNamevarchar房屋类型名称,该栏必填表1.出租房屋信息表house_house结构列名称数据类型说明HMIDint出租房屋编号,主键,标识列从1开始,递增值为1UserIdvarchar客户编号,该栏必填,外键StreetIDint街道编号,该栏必填,外键HTIdint房屋类型编号,该栏必填,外键Pricedecimal月租金,该栏必填,默认值为0,要求大于等于0Topicvarchar标题,该栏必填Contentsvarchar描述,该栏必填HTimedatetime发布时间,该栏必填,默认值为当前日期,要求不大于当前日期Copyvarchar备注4、开发环

5、境数据库:SQLSERVER2008及以上版本5、实训进度安排实训进度安排如下表所示:6、成绩考核1.实训项目为8分,完成实训1-3为5分,完成实训1-4为8分,完成实训1-5最高可达到12分。2.凡是报优的同学需做实训5。3.凡实训项目雷同,直接视同不及格。251567159118陈伟光《我的租房网》实训报告《数据库技术与应用》工程实训设计报告目录内蒙古科技大学实训任务书I目录III实训一、建立数据库结构41.1创建数据库41.2建立5张表51.3添加外键约束8实训二、添加测试数据92.1主表添加测试数据92.2建立临时表132.3添加批量数据14实训三、综合查询163.1分页显示

6、查询出租房屋信息163.2查询指定客户发布的出租房屋信息173.3按区县制作房屋出租清单19实训四、业务统计204.1按季度统计本年度发布的房屋出租数量204.2统计出本年度各个季度各个区县出租房屋的数量214.3统计出各个季度各个区县出租房屋的数量总和及街道户型明细22心得体会24参考文献25致谢25251567159118陈伟光《我的租房网》实训报告《数据库技术与应用》工程实训设计报告实训一、建立数据库结构1.1创建数据库(1)创建数据库House使用SSMS向导创建数据库House,相关参数自行设定,如下图所示:图1.创建数据库House创建数据库的操作如下图所示:图2.创建数

7、据库House251567159118陈伟光《我的租房网》实训报告《数据库技术与应用》工程实训设计报告图1.创建数据库设置界面1.1建立5张表要求使用T-SQL语句建立5张数据表及相应的各种约束,要求遵循编程规范及添加注释。注意:字段名不能使用T-SQL关键字,另外外键和主键数据类型要求一致。根据表6,新建查询创建house_user表表1.客户信息表house_user结构列名称数据类型说明UserIdint客户编号,主键,标识列从1开始,递增值为1Us

当前文档最多预览五页,下载文档查看全文

此文档下载收益归作者所有

当前文档最多预览五页,下载文档查看全文
温馨提示:
1. 部分包含数学公式或PPT动画的文件,查看预览时可能会显示错乱或异常,文件下载后无此问题,请放心下载。
2. 本文档由用户上传,版权归属用户,天天文库负责整理代发布。如果您对本文档版权有争议请及时联系客服。
3. 下载前请仔细阅读文档内容,确认文档内容符合您的需求后进行下载,若出现内容与标题不符可向本站投诉处理。
4. 下载文档时可能由于网络波动等原因无法下载或下载错误,付费完成后未能成功下载的用户请联系客服处理。